Output 76ff511f3b1d89b7a975d2f5a657a62fcd36d537c95462b3ba4a45a21271956e:14

value
125000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6180b2f7cf3a7e4750b012099c8286610c350d23 OP_EQUAL
address
3AaZeKaTQjBWMNpe5PCFxUPGHgiVBTbroz
transaction
76ff511f3b1d89b7a975d2f5a657a62fcd36d537c95462b3ba4a45a21271956e
confirmations
362349
spent
true